A company is bankrupt if it can not pay its financial obligations as they fall due. It may additionally be insolvent if its liabilities exceed its assets. An administrator aims to save the firm and potentially offer it while it remains to trade (liquidation company). The managers that run the insolvent business might search for a buyer for the company. If a buyer is found, employees may move to the purchaser under TUPE and be gone on in their present duties, yet it is also possible that there will be redundancies.




Your connection of solution will certainly consequently be preserved. If the business is to be offered and TUPE uses, you would preserve continual employment. However, it is common for managers to make redundancies if the company no much longer has adequate funds to proceed paying employees. Specific payments including redundancy, legal notice and a quantity of overdue wages may be recoverable from the National Insurance Policy Fund (NIF) see listed below for even more. http://peterjackson.mee.nu/where_i_work#c2236.

If you unfortunately lose your work as a result of your company's insolvency, there are choices for recovering money that you may be owed. Some types of pay you may be owed include the following: Redundancy pay; Holiday pay; Statutory or legal notification pay; Pension plan contributions; Family members pay such as maternal pay; Other amounts such as unpaid earnings, payments or bonus offers.


If you were a self-employed contractor of business, you will certainly not be able to make any claims to the National Insurance Coverage Fund. Rather you will need to assert from the financially troubled organization as a lender, and there is another process to follow. You might be able to claim from the NIF holiday days owed to you that you did not take or holiday days that you took however for which you were not paid, based on qualification needs.


It can take 6 weeks or longer to obtain the repayment. The info you supply is inspected against your company's documents and you will only obtain a payment if those documents show that you are owed money. Please keep in mind that any kind of advantages that you are qualified to case will be deducted from your legal notification repayment (also if you did not declare them).

However, TUPE supplies better adaptability in some aspects to the transferees (i.e. the brand-new company) of insolvent companies. Where the employer remains in management or under a CVA, some 'normal' TUPE rules apply including that workers will automatically move to the transferee and additionally obtain improved unfair termination security for employees with 2 or even more years' constant service.


These certain liabilities consist of financial obligations of pay, holiday pay and statutory notification pay reflecting the payments that you can recoup from the NIF as outlined above. If there are any kind of sums as a result of you which are not covered by the NIF (i.e. they are a various type of financial debt or they surpass the maximum quantities covered by the NIF), these debts will certainly move to the transferee.
